Industrial Relations Commission of New South Wales in Court Session
CITATION : Insp Plowright v Peter J Davis (Newcastle) Pty Limited [2001] NSWIRComm 269 PROSECUTION: PARTIES : Inspector Plowright DEFENDANT: Peter J Davis (Newcastle) Pty Limited FILE NUMBER: IRC562 of 2001 CORAM: Kavanagh J CATCHWORDS : Plea of not guilty to charge under s16(1) of the Occupational Health and Safety Act 1983 - Whether the site, on the date of the incident, was a "place of work" of the defendant company - Whether there had been a "hand over" of a single apartment on a floor of an apartment block which block had six apartments on each floor - "Place of work" a question of fact - Work still being performed by the defendant company on site - Defendant company required to perform other variations and detailing on the site - Finding the breach occurred at the site of an undertaking of the defendant company at its place of work - Breach found proven LEGISLATION CITED : Occupational Health and Safety Act 1983 s16(1) Mainbrace Constructions Pty Ltd v WorkCover Authority of NSW (Inspector Charles) (2000) 102 IR 84 CASES CITED : Kirkby v A & M I Hanson Pty Limited (1994) 55 IR 40 WorkCover Authority of New South Wales (Inspector Keenan) v Technical and Further Education Commission (1999) 92 IR 251 Insp Maltby v Harris Excavation and Demolition Pty Ltd (unreported, Cahill V-P, CT1144 of 1995, 2 May 1997) HEARING DATES: 09/11/2001; 09/12/2001 DATE OF JUDGMENT: 11/01/2001
